Origin and meaning of the name Françoise-luise

What is the origin of the name Françoise-luise?

The name Francoise is of French origin, derived from the Latin name Franciscus, meaning "Frenchman" or "free man." The name Luise is of German origin, a variant of the name Louise which means "renowned warrior" or "famous in battle."

The meaning, etymology, and origin of the name Françoise-luise

The name Francoise Luise is a combination of the French name Francoise, meaning "a free woman", and the German name Luise, meaning "famous warrior". Francoise is of French origin and has been a popular name for girls in France for centuries. Luise is of German origin and has been commonly used in Germany and other German-speaking countries. The combination of these two names creates a unique and strong name for a girl, reflecting qualities of freedom and strength. It may also symbolize a blending of French and German cultural influences.
